Strange But True

Strange But True

Past Life / The Most Haunted Village in England (3x3)


Air date: Sep 13, 1996

Past Lives and the story of the village of Pluckley

  • Rank #
  • Premiered: May 1993
  • Episodes: 39
  • Followers: 0
  • Ended
  • ITV1
  • Unknown